At Kidz Mob our values are the Six C's which are Community, Culture, Care, Creativity, Choice, and Collaboration. These values underpin everything that we do.

Our philosophy, which stems from our motto, learning from the Dreamtime, acknowledges the wisdom, culture and beliefs of the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ander people that has been passed on through generations. Kidz Mob believes that incorporating Indigenous culture, and the culture of families who attend our services, is the key to fostering a community of services that are inclusive, environmentally conscious, and a safe space for all children.
Kidz Mob commits to strengthening our practices and respectfully embedding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ples' cultures into all of our programs and service delivery is at the forefront of our organisations philosophy. Kidz Mob Mapleton's services vision for reconciliation is to create a culturally safe, inclusive environment for children, Educators, parents and the wider community. We will achieve this vision through providing high quality, culturally appropriate programs for school aged children throughout our service and will build meaningful relationships with local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Elders and people to engage with our service in a range of capacities. We will support children through our programs to acknowledge and learn about Australia's shared history, and the inter-generational impacts that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ander people have faced since colonisation. We want to guide and actively encourage our Outside School Hours Care sector to reflect and improve the expectations on OSHC services around the respectful embedding of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ples' cultures. Particularly, we want to advocate for the National Quality Standards (NQS) to acknowledge the need for each childcare/OSHC service to have an active Reconciliation Action Plan that they engage with and contribute too, as part of a service's rating and assessment. We believe that the embedding of this into the NQS will be a step towards ensuring that all childcare/OSHC services are culturally safe for all children but in particular that of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ander children and people.

We were very fortunate to attend the 2026 Musgrave Park Family Fun Day. This is Australia's largest NAIDOC Cultural Celebration! This event is a family friendly festival filled with live entertainment, exhibits and activities showcasing First Nations People, Culture and Heritage.
At our stall we had a free kids game we created called "Native Paws and Claws". Children and adults had to match the Australian animal bean bag faces to the paw or claw print on the board, and then toss them through! The activity was a big hit and anyone who participated received a bubble wand, frisbee or playdough! We cannot wait to be apart of this deadly event next year.
